System Design Interview: A Repeatable Framework (With Examples)
A practical step-by-step approach to system design interviews: requirements, APIs, data model, scaling, tradeoffs, and a checklist you can reuse.
2/5/2026by MicroStudio
A practical step-by-step approach to system design interviews: requirements, APIs, data model, scaling, tradeoffs, and a checklist you can reuse.
Communication, edge cases, complexity, and debugging. A practical guide to performing well in coding interviews without freezing.
How to structure behavioral answers with STAR and still sound human. Includes examples engineers can adapt.
A focused checklist for ML interviews: metrics, bias/variance, model selection, experimentation, and ML system design.
A practical checklist for remote interviews: hardware, network, screen sharing, note-taking, and privacy/consent basics.